From 195a3d15e490465b64a19d2f09e8a2d8d81e2b2a Mon Sep 17 00:00:00 2001 From: Bent Bisballe Nyeng Date: Mon, 6 Jun 2016 20:26:13 +0200 Subject: Add basic latency reporting methods. --- src/drumgizmo.cc |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'src/drumgizmo.cc') diff --git a/src/drumgizmo.cc b/src/drumgizmo.cc index ef4d3b6..a1278a1 100644 --- a/src/drumgizmo.cc +++ b/src/drumgizmo.cc @@ -410,6 +410,11 @@ void DrumGizmo::stop() // engine.stop(); } +std::size_t DrumGizmo::getLatency() const +{ + return input_processor.getLatency() + resamplers.getLatency(); +} + int DrumGizmo::samplerate() { return settings.samplerate.load(); -- cgit v1.2.3